WebMar 5, 2024 · 4. Use a phrase with the word hasta. In Spanish, "hasta" means "until." There are several phrases using this word that can be used to tell someone goodbye. Some of these phrases specifically say when you will next see the person. [4] Hasta mañana means "until tomorrow." Pronounce it AHS-tuh men-YAHN-uh. WebNov 22, 2024 · The main difference between English and Spanish vowels. Both languages have 5 written vowels: A, E, I, O, and U. However, the English language has between 14 and 21 vowel sounds, while Spanish has only 5 vowel sounds. Every Spanish vowel is always pronounced the same way.
